Synopsis
This futuristic musical is set in a small-town railway station, sometime all too soon.
Harry Wooller, a vicar, is looking for sponsorship for his group's musical Mystery play.
His call is intercepted by a dubious but immensely powerful source - Valda/Valder who alternates between male and female forms.
Artistry is soon compromised; this drastic interference forces the group to reveal their past deeds, and recognise the need for change.

A Word From Our Sponsor is a British play written by John Pattison and published by Samuel French in London (1998).
